What Is the Long Change in Hockey?

TLDR: The long change happens every second period — teams switch ends and suddenly their bench is on the far side of the ice from their defensive zone. Players have to skate roughly 50 extra feet just to get off for a line change, which leads to longer shifts, tired legs, bad decisions, and — […]

Are Hockey Arenas Cold? (Yes — Here’s What to Expect)

Quick Answer: Yes, hockey arenas are cold — but not as cold as you might think. NHL arenas are kept between 60°F and 65°F (15–18°C), which feels more like a cool movie theatre than a freezer.
